Transaction 128e074d737000c24fc6de98e7e7c9aa423b75fc3fae3879dc829df1fc5abd8f

20 Input
1 Outputs
  • 128e074d737000c24fc6de98e7e7c9aa423b75fc3fae3879dc829df1fc5abd8f:0
  • value  765529
    address  18hGbwCYgKvGV9137j4hzckBBiZ3dRUyfx